Onboarding — night shift, Merridew Logistics

While the main depot at Fenwick Yard is under renovation, night operations run from the temporary site on Larch Row. Park in the marked overflow bays, sign the night register at the cabin, and keep hi-vis on at all times between buildings. Your permanent badge will not work here until reissued, so enter through the side gate using the code below.

staff pass of kawip-hawef = bdg-QLP-2

Leadership Review Briefing — Retail Pilot

Finance folks, quick rundown: the pilot with the Quillow Stores chain kicks off next month in six locations around Marsh Hollow. We're fronting the fixture costs (about 40k) and they take consignment terms for the first eight weeks. If sell-through clears 60%, we convert to standard wholesale. Keep an eye on the consignment accruals — they'll look odd in month one. Why we're doing this is summed up below.

confidential, kagep-kahof: Druokax Systems plans to lower the Ulaath list price by 53 percent in March.

Handover — image slimming on Copperknell (for weekly eng sync)

From Ilya to Marguerite: base image is now the distroless Thornquist build; size dropped 62%. Remaining work: strip debug symbols from the parser layer and verify healthchecks still pass without a shell. Build cache keys are documented in the runbook. To decrypt the signed build manifest, use the recovery passphrase below.

vault phrase of yagag-yafof = belael-weniel-kasion-silath-jorax-pelox-silir-soreth-ralmir

**Vendor note: Inkmill markdown pipeline**

Rendering for Parchway docs is outsourced to Inkmill under an annual contract, renewing each March. They handle sanitization and PDF export; we own the upload queue. SLA: 4-hour response on rendering failures. Escalate only after two failed retries. Their support desk is reachable at the address below.

billing contact of hahaf-baguf = zorael.tammir.jorius@sivrelhq.internal